1. Bullish Momentum Strong
Bitcoin recently shot past $100,000, reaching intraday highs around $101,370.
Institutional demand is a big driver. Spot BTC ETFs are seeing huge inflows — Standard Chartered reported $5.3 billion in a few weeks.
Big companies like Strategy (Michael Saylor’s firm) are accumulating more BTC, signaling long-term confidence.
2. On-Chain Signals Are Bullish
Miners are holding strongly — they aren’t selling even as prices rise, which is historically a bullish sign.
According to ARK Invest, BTC’s support levels are consolidating around $94,000–$97,000.
3. Macro Tailwinds
The U.S. is supporting Bitcoin: a strategic Bitcoin reserve idea (backed by Trump) is giving long-term bullish credibility.
Rate cut expectations from the Fed are boosting risk-asset appetite, which helps BTC.
4. Risks & Caution
Bitcoin is nearing overbought territory; some technicals (like RSI) suggest a short-term pullback or consolidation could happen.
Long-dormant wallets (with huge BTC holdings) have woken up — if they decide to sell, it could cause volatility.
Low trading volume sometimes amplifies sharp moves, so risk remains.
5. Forecast
According to CoinCodex, BTC could trade in a wide range between ~$104,500 and ~$143,700 for 2025.
Some long-term bullish analysts see $150,000+ potential if ETF inflows and macro tailwinds stay strong.
